Why Are Traditional SEO Agencies in Winnipeg So Costly and Opaque?

Traditional Winnipeg SEO agencies are expensive because their model is built on billable hours, account managers, and manual reporting. A typical retainer covers keyword research, content writing, link outreach, and monthly calls — but clients rarely see a plain-English breakdown of each task performed. You get a PDF report, a few ranking graphs, and a renewal invoice.

The opacity is structural. Agencies bundle work into packages so it's hard to audit line by line. When rankings don't move, the answer is usually "SEO takes time" — which is true, but it's also a convenient shield. For a Winnipeg salon owner or a solo founder, paying a significant monthly amount without knowing what was actually done is a real business risk. Google's Search Quality Rater Guidelines use the E-E-A-T framework —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ness — to evaluate content quality, yet most agency retainers never mention it in their deliverables.


The Hidden Risks of Generic AI SEO Tools and DIY Data Dumps

Not all alternatives to expensive seo agency winnipeg are safe. Cheap AI content generators produce high-volume, generic text that triggers Google's Helpful Content system — introduced in 2022 to reward content written for people, not for rankings. Sites hit by that system see traffic drop sharply, sometimes within weeks.

DIY keyword tools have a different problem. They dump data without direction. A business owner searching through content on a webpage for SEO signals gets a spreadsheet of numbers but no clear path to action. Without someone to interpret the data, most of it goes unused. Tools like Google Search Console are free and surface real crawl and indexing data, but reading a Coverage report or a Core Web Vitals dashboard still requires context that most small business owners simply don't have time to develop.

The two failure modes are opposite but equally costly:

  • Generic AI output: fast to produce, risky to publish, embarrassing when it misrepresents your brand
  • Raw data tools: accurate but directionless, requiring expertise most small owners don't have time to build

Why Verified Business Facts Beat Generic AI Output Every Time

Generic AI content is built from patterns in public data. It produces text that sounds plausible but contains no facts specific to your business. A Winnipeg salon article written by a generic AI tool will read the same as one written for a salon in Calgary or Toronto — because it is the same article, reskinned.

Verified business facts — your specific services, your local expertise, your real client outcomes — are what Google's E-E-A-T framework rewards. The "Experience" signal, added to E-A-T in December 2022, specifically looks for first-hand knowledge that only a real practitioner could provide. Generic output cannot fake that signal reliably.

When content is built from your own verified facts, it also performs better in AI answer engines. Perplexity and ChatGPT cite sources that contain specific, attributable claims — not generic summaries. That's the core logic behind AEO, and it's why fact-grounded content outperforms volume-driven content in the AI search layer.
